Output 40759265d48403129a53e9bffbdef4ce511a743642876f7e8f7ba4614ef9acba:4

value
9596170
script pubkey
OP_0 OP_PUSHBYTES_20 076a6fc57aa696e6ae167cae1d3a75c3d6d5509c
address
ltc1qqa4xl3t656twdtsk0jhp6wn4c0td25yue45xe2
transaction
40759265d48403129a53e9bffbdef4ce511a743642876f7e8f7ba4614ef9acba
spent
true